📖 Definitions of "Flats"
noun
- 1
An area of level ground.
- 2
A note played a semitone lower than a natural, denoted by the symbol ♭ placed after the letter representing the note (e.g., B♭) or in front of the note symbol (e.g. ♭♪).
- 3
A flat tyre/tire.
- 4
(in the plural) A type of ladies' shoes with very low heels.
"She liked to walk in her flats more than in her high heels."
verb
- 1
To make a flat call; to call without raising.
- 2
To become flat or flattened; to sink or fall to an even surface.
- 3
To fall from the pitch.
- 4
To depress in tone, as a musical note; especially, to lower in pitch by half a tone.
noun
- 1
An apartment, usually on one level and usually consisting of more than one room.
verb
- 1
To beat or strike; pound
- 2
To dash or throw
- 3
To dash, rush
